Belgian cyclist Tim Wellens has confirmed he will not participate in the upcoming UCI World Championships, despite being invited by team leader Remco Evenepoel. Wellens explained his decision was based on a commitment to support his team during a difficult period marked by multiple injuries. Although Evenepoel personally requested his participation via message, Wellens emphasized his loyalty to his team over national representation. He highlighted that his absence would allow him to compete in races overlapping with the World Championships, where he previously won in 2015. Wellens stated he had already promised to assist his team, which is struggling with player shortages due to injuries.
